普莱柯公告称,经农业农村部审查,批准公司及全资子公司洛阳惠中兽药有限公司等联合申报的"氟雷 拉纳咀嚼片"为新兽药,并公示核发《新兽药注册证书》。该兽药为二类,主要成分氟雷拉纳,用于治 疗犬体表蜱虫、跳蚤感染。其驱杀作用可持续12周,采用软咀嚼片制备工艺,适口性好。产品上市前还 应取得兽药产品批准文号,这对公司提升竞争力、推动宠物板块业绩增长有积极作用。 ...

格隆汇1月8日丨普莱柯(603566.SH)公布,根据《兽药管理条例》和《兽药注册办法》规定,经农业农 村部审查,批准公司及全资子公司洛阳惠中兽药有限公司等单位联合申报的"氟雷拉纳咀嚼片"为新兽 药,并于2026年1月7日公示了核发《新兽药注册证书》(中华人民共和国农业农村部公告第986号)事 项。 适应症:用于治疗犬体表的蜱虫(血红扇头蜱)、跳蚤(猫栉首蚤、犬栉首蚤)感染,可作为控制跳蚤 过敏性皮炎方案的一部分来应用。 ...

Summary by Sections Industry Overview - The report focuses on the pet hospital industry in China, analyzing its layout, treatment volume, and business models to understand the current development status and market size [3][4]. Market Growth and Structure - As of 2024, there are 22,320 registered animal treatment institutions in mainland China, marking a 10% increase from 2023,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.7% from 2020 to 2024. Single hospitals still dominate the market, accounting for 78.9% of the total, while chain institutions represent 21.1% [5][8]. - The distribution of pet hospitals is uneven, with Guangdong leading at 2,408 hospitals, followed by Jiangsu with 2,218. First-tier and new first-tier cities account for 36.3% of the total number of pet hospitals [8] . Treatment Types and Consumer Satisfaction - In 2023-2024, the treatment for pet dogs is primarily focused on medical care, increasing from 47.6% to 49.0%. For cats, the immunization rate is between 39.8% and 40.5%, with nearly 36% for medical treatment, indicating a diverse medical demand [14]. - Consumer satisfaction regarding treatment services fluctuated, with satisfaction rates dropping from 70.8% in 2023 to 66.2% in 2024. The main dissatisfaction stems from high prices and lack of transparency, with 50.7% and 53.5% of consumers citing these issues in 2023 and 2024, respectively [14][19]. Financial Performance and Market Dynamics - The market shows a complex landscape, with no significant overall growth in monthly revenue, but changes in revenue structure. The proportion of institutions with monthly revenue below 100,000 yuan has slightly increased, while the average customer price has seen a slight rise in 2024 [21]. - Profit margins have generally declined, with a 5% decrease in 2024 compared to the previous year, indicating increased competition and the need for cost control and service quality improvement [21][19]. Competitive Landscape - The report identifies a competitive landscape dominated by three major players: New Ruipeng, Ruipai, and Ruichen, which have established a "three-strong" competitive structure. These companies focus on service quality and operational efficiency rather than merely expanding the number of stores [24][30]. - The report emphasizes the need for continuous innovation and enhancement of competitive capabilities among pet healthcare chains to adapt to market changes and meet evolving consumer demands [30]. Financing Environment - The pet industry has seen fluctuations in private equity and venture capital financing, with a peak of 82 events in 2021, followed by a sharp decline to 29 events in 2024. This indicates a cautious investment climate as the industry transitions into a new phase of quality improvement [28][30]. Future Trends - The report suggests that the future of the pet healthcare industry will focus on specialization and digitalization, with leading chain hospitals optimizing resources and exploring lower-tier markets to drive growth [31].

Core Insights - The report highlights a significant rebound in pork prices before the New Year, with the average price of lean pigs reaching 12.39 CNY/kg, a 7.6% increase from the previous week, although it remains 19.7% lower year-on-year [5][13][23] - The implementation of a safeguard policy for beef import quotas is expected to alleviate domestic supply pressures, with a total import quota of 2.688 million tons for 2026, which is 93.5% of the total imports in 2024 [14] - The report recommends focusing on leading companies with cost advantages in the livestock sector, particularly Wens Foodstuff and Muyuan Foods, while also highlighting potential turnaround candidates like Zhengbang Technology [5][13] Livestock Farming - The report notes that the pork market is under pressure due to significant losses in the industry, but the reduction in production capacity is expected to accelerate, leading to a more stable price environment in the first half of 2026 [5][13] - For poultry, the average price of white feather chickens is reported at 3.78 CNY/lb, down 3.1% week-on-week, while yellow feather chicken prices have shown slight increases, benefiting companies like Lihua and Wens [5][13][32] Dairy Industry - The current price of fresh milk in major production areas is 3.03 CNY/kg, stable week-on-week but down 3.2% year-on-year, indicating a balance in supply and demand as inventory levels decrease [14] - The safeguard measures on beef imports are anticipated to support domestic beef prices, which are expected to rise, enhancing the performance of companies like Yurun and Modern Farming [14] Feed and Animal Health - The report indicates a rebound in aquaculture prices due to holiday demand, with significant increases in white shrimp prices leading up to the New Year [15] - The feed industry is facing intense competition, but leading companies are expected to gain market share due to their cost advantages, especially in international markets [15] Agricultural Sector Performance - The agricultural sector outperformed the market by 0.7 percentage points, with livestock farming and feed sectors showing the highest gains of 1.4% and 0.5%, respectively [21] - The report tracks various agricultural product prices, noting fluctuations in corn and soybean meal prices, with corn prices rising by 0.6% to 2352 CNY/ton [23][46]
